Transaction 63b8b59d9e6980bb233f27707626b8433852a24d12eef5d0255f5aa3b5631019
1 Input
1 Output
-
63b8b59d9e6980bb233f27707626b8433852a24d12eef5d0255f5aa3b5631019:0
- value
- 267513
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5b76a30534573bdaee73ba3524339d856e9ec6f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LV2ek8SU9rTk5KNFSdpJnPUzEi8xpHgVo